Mjällby is a football club based in Sölvesborg, Sweden, playing their home matches at Strandvallen. Follow Mjällby on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, squad information, transfer news, and comprehensive performance analytics.

Elliot Stroud has been the standout performer for Mjällby in league play this season with a rating of 7.94. Abdoulie Manneh and Ludwig Thorell have also impressed with ratings of 7.49 and 7.47 respectively.

Jacob Bergström leads Mjällby's scoring in league play with 4 goals this season. Abdoulie Manneh has contributed 2, while Elliot Stroud has added 2.

Abdoulie Manneh is the chief creator for Mjällby in league play with 2 assists this season. Jesper Gustavsson and Elliot Stroud have also been key playmakers with 2 and 1 assists respectively.

Mjällby have been in excellent form recently, winning 4 of their last 5 matches (80% win rate). They have scored 12 goals and conceded 3 during this period. Overall, they have shown good attacking threat. Defensively, they have been solid, conceding an average of 0.6 goals per game. In the Allsvenskan, their recent results include a 3-0 win against Brommapojkarna, a 0-0 draw with GAIS, a 2-0 win against Halmstads BK, a 3-2 win against Malmö FF, and a 4-1 win against Degerfors.

Mjällby's squad consists of 29 players. Goalkeepers: Amar Dzevlan (Sweden), Robin Wallinder (Sweden), Hugo Fagerberg (Sweden), Alexander Lundin (Sweden). Defenders: Ludvig Svanberg (Sweden), Christian Tchouante (Cameroon), Axel Norén (Sweden), Abdullah Iqbal (Pakistan), Tom Pettersson (Sweden), Max Nielsen (Denmark), Ludvig Tidstrand (Sweden), Tony Miettinen (Finland). Midfielders: Ludwig Thorell (Sweden), Teo Helge (Sweden), Timo Stavitski (Finland), Villiam Granath (Sweden), Elliot Stroud (Sweden), Måns Isaksson (Sweden), Jesper Gustavsson (Sweden), Olle Lindberg (Sweden), Romeo Leandersson (Sweden). Forwards: Olle Nilsson Loev (Sweden), Viktor Gustafson (Sweden), Jeppe Kjær (Denmark), Bork Classønn Bang-Kittilsen (Norway), Jacob Bergström (Sweden), Abdoulie Manneh (Gambia), Ibrahim Adewale (Nigeria), Áki Samuelsen (Faroe Islands).

Mjällby transfers: New signings include Villiam Granath (from Halmstads BK), Max Nielsen (from Hobro), Áki Samuelsen (from Ranheim), Robin Wallinder (from Östers IF), Noel Törnqvist (from Como) and 4 more. Players transferred out include Love Björnson (to Hässleholms IF), Johan Persson Åhstedt (to Hässleholms IF), Isac Johnsson (to Solvesborgs GoIF), Kimmen Nennesson (to Enköping), Filip Åkesson Linderoth (to Solvesborgs GoIF) and 15 more.

Anders Torstensson is the current head coach of Mjällby. Under their leadership, the team has achieved a 42% win rate across 84 matches, averaging 1.43 points per game.

Notable previous managers include Andreas Brännström managed the club for one season, recording 11 wins from 30 matches (37% win rate). Christian Järdler managed the club for one season, recording 4 wins from 21 matches (19% win rate). Other former coaches include Marcus Lantz, Milos Milojevic, and Peter Swärdh.

Mjällby plays their home matches at Strandvallen in Sölvesborg, which has a capacity of 7,500.
